3/26 A fictitious glory settled upon me then, from which I have never escaped. They called me Hannibal. It confirmed me in a false position. There was no chance of not being a hero with such a name, and I was in for it literally before I knew where I was. I must have been eighteen months at the time, but when the word went forth, "Hannibal walks!" I was simply deafened by the applause which greeted my feat. |
